Boxing’s heavyweight division has entered an unstable state with rumors coming from all directions. Amid these heavy rumors, former unified heavyweight champion, Anthony Joshua took to social media to turn down all hustling speculations of him taking 15 million euros to give way to undisputed heavyweight title clash.
In the video that surfaced on social media platforms, ‘AJ‘ boldly denied any contract. He said, “You know what’s bad about all these interviews I see. I see certain interviews that quote what I said and I think to myself, I ain’t done no interviews. Where did this person get this information from? I’m hearing people saying ‘AJ’ accepts 15 million to step aside. I ain’t signed no contract.”

“I ain’t seen no contract. So as it stands, stop listening to the bulls**t until it comes from me. I am the man in control of my destiny, I am the man that handles my business. I’m a smart individual and I make calculated decisions every step of the way. Don’t listen to the bulls**t from other sources.”

After months of uncertainty, Usyk and Joshua’s rematch is still not certified. However, only speculations are being made by boxing spectators as per the contract.
Notably, the mandatory rematch clause is a hurdle, as many want to see an undisputed showdown between Oleksandr Usyk and Tyson Fury. Aware of these facts, Joshua is still practicing hard in the gym for a comeback fight, as the rematch against ‘The Cat‘ is not off.
